How Intelligent Phone Systems Improve Call Routing

An intelligent cloud phone system is designed to guide calls based on logic, not guesswork.

Routing Based on Need

Calls are directed based on what the customer is calling about, not just who is available.

Time-Based Routing

Calls can be handled differently depending on business hours, peak times, or after-hours needs.

Role-Based Routing

Customers are connected to the right department or team member from the start.

Location Flexibility

Calls can reach employees whether they are in Brentwood, Franklin, Nashville, or out working in Columbia.

This creates a system that works consistently, regardless of circumstances.

Why Setup Makes All the Difference

Call routing is not something that works automatically out of the box.

It needs to be designed around your business.

That includes:

Understanding common call types
Mapping out call flows
Identifying key roles and responsibilities
Aligning routing with how your team works

When done correctly, the system feels natural.

When done poorly, it creates more problems than it solves.
